What are the admission tests?

Mondragon Unibertsitatea has defined the admission test as a key mechanism to ensure that students entering the degree programmes have the necessary competences to adapt and thrive in the academic and professional enviroment promoted by the institution. The competences to be assessed have been selected with the aim of aligning the students profile with the pedagogical framework of the model.

The tests consist of two parts, an individual test and a team test. In those cases where it is considered appropiate, the candidate will be called for a personal interview or will be asked for additional documentation.

In these tests, the following competencies will be assessed:

Oral Communication

The ability to transmit ideas in a clear, structured and effective manner in Basque, Spanish and/or English, according to the requirements of the degree. This may be evaluated by means of oral presentations, debates or presentations of ideas. 

Teamwork

The ability to collaborate effectively with others, contributing to the achievement of common goals. It can be assessed through group dynamics or collaborative projects. 

Critical Analysis

The ability to analyse information, identify problems, formulate solutions and make informed descisions. This compentence may be evaluated through exercises that require a reflective approach, such as case analysis or problem solving.

 

Cooperation

Beyond teamwork, this competence involves the ability to collaborate in an active and committed way, integrating one's own efforts with those of others to generate positive synergies. It can be assessed trhough activities involving constant interaction, such as role-playing and simulations.

Curiosity and Entrepreneurial Attitude

The desire to learn, openness to change and ability to propose new ideas are valued. These competences may be evaluated with questions or activities that require creativity, innovation and a willingness to learn continuously. 

 

The result of the admission test will be expressed in terms of PASS or FAIL. A PASS result will indicate that the student meets the required competence profile for the study programme, while a FAIL result will reflect the need to reinforce some areas in order to be admitted to Mondragon Uniberstiatea
